The worst Italian restaurant in Round Rock. I got to the restaurant after reading some of the great reviews here, I was terribly disappointed. The house salad was one of the worst I have had, the Salmon was not fresh and overcooked, to cover for that fact it was heavily glazed the pasta was over-coocked as well. Both the salad and salmon had way too much salt on them.

I will never go back to Carino's

Never been disappointed here. We have eaten here several times and never been disappointed. They offer family meals, which for us has actually fed more than the menu listed. Their Sicilian Fire Sticks appetizer is the bomb! We order it every time we're in here. We like everything we've tried on the menu so far. We haven't tried any dessert as of yet because we've been to full for it. We enjoy eating at this restaurant and are repeated customers.
